Recall is the process of accessing information without cues, while recognition involves identifying previously learned information after encountering it again. For example, when you take a multiple-choice test, you rely on recognition to choose the correct answer. On the other hand, recall is used for tasks like writing an essay test or trying to remember someone's name without any prompts.
